本文目錄導(dǎo)讀:
網(wǎng)頁(yè)設(shè)計(jì)之CSS文件編寫指南
在網(wǎng)頁(yè)設(shè)計(jì)中,CSS(層疊樣式表)文件扮演著***關(guān)重要的角色,它負(fù)責(zé)描述網(wǎng)頁(yè)的外觀和格式,使得網(wǎng)頁(yè)內(nèi)容能夠以特定的方式呈現(xiàn)給用戶,本指南將幫助你了解如何編寫CSS文件,以及如何通過CSS來優(yōu)化網(wǎng)頁(yè)的排版和布局。
CSS文件的基本結(jié)構(gòu)
CSS文件由一系列的選擇器、屬性和值組成,每個(gè)選擇器用于指定應(yīng)用樣式的HTML元素,屬性則定義該元素的外觀和布局,值則指定屬性的具體設(shè)置。
常見的CSS選擇器
1、元素選擇器:根據(jù)HTML元素類型選擇,如div
,p
,a
等。
2、類選擇器:通過元素的class屬性選擇,如.myClass
。
3、ID選擇器:通過元素的id屬性選擇,如#myId
。
CSS屬性的常見類型
1、長(zhǎng)度單位:如px
、em
、rem
等,用于定義長(zhǎng)度和大小。
2、百分比:用于定義長(zhǎng)度和大小的百分比值。
3、顏色:使用十六進(jìn)制、RGB或HSL表示顏色。
CSS文件的編寫技巧
1、遵循良好的命名規(guī)范:變量名應(yīng)簡(jiǎn)潔明了,避免使用無意義的字符。
2、使用預(yù)處理器:如Sass或Less,可以擴(kuò)展CSS的功能,提高開發(fā)效率。
3、避免過度使用ID選擇器:ID選擇器雖然具有***性,但過度使用可能導(dǎo)致代碼冗余和維護(hù)困難。
優(yōu)化網(wǎng)頁(yè)排版的CSS技巧
1、使用負(fù)邊距:通過負(fù)邊距可以調(diào)整元素之間的間距,實(shí)現(xiàn)更靈活的布局。
2、利用偽元素:偽元素如::before
和::after
可以用于在元素內(nèi)容前后插入裝飾性的內(nèi)容或元素。
3、響應(yīng)式設(shè)計(jì):確保你的CSS能夠適應(yīng)不同設(shè)備和屏幕尺寸,提供一致的用戶體驗(yàn)。
通過學(xué)習(xí)和實(shí)踐,你可以掌握CSS文件的編寫技巧,并應(yīng)用于網(wǎng)頁(yè)設(shè)計(jì)中,不斷學(xué)習(xí)和探索新的CSS技術(shù)和工具,將使你能夠創(chuàng)造出更加美觀、實(shí)用的網(wǎng)頁(yè)應(yīng)用。